Introduction to Probiotics and Their Importance

Probiotics are live microorganisms that confer health benefits when consumed, generally by improving or restoring the gut flora. They play a crucial role in our digestive system, aiding in the breakdown of food, absorption of nutrients, and the synthesis of certain vitamins. Moreover, probiotics have been linked to various health benefits, including improved immune function, enhanced mental health, and even weight management. While probiotics are often associated with fermented foods like yogurt and kefir, certain fruits are also rich in these beneficial bacteria.
